BALE RULED OUT

Real Madrid manager Carlo Ancelotti has ruled out star summer signing Gareth Bale from the upcoming la Liga match against Athletic Bilbao. The £ 86 million man has suffered a small problem in his leg, which will prevent him from playing, but he should be fit for the Copa del Rey encounter against Atletico Madrid according to Ancelotti.

Bale has not been the best player in Real Madrid's colours this campaign and it has been largely due to a succession of fitness problems. He was not involved in the pre-season form of Tottenham and Real Madrid as he was busy completing his protracted transfer saga.

SPAIN CHAT PLANNED

The manager of the Wales national football team, Chris Coleman, is planning to go to Spain to have a chat with the Real Madrid officials regarding the availability of Gareth Bale for the international matches in future.

Bale himself wants to feature in each and every international game of Wales, but, Real Madrid is not fine with that. The Spanish club doesn’t want to risk the fitness of the 24 years old winger.

Chris Coleman has no problem in excusing Bale for the low profile games like the friendly ones, but, he wants him to be available for selection for the vital games like the Euro Cup qualifying games.

Bale has had some fitness concerns in the recent past because of which he has missed a few games for Real Madrid. Even while featuring for Wales in the game against Finland a couple of days back, he had suffered a minor injury.

KEEP BALE

Tottenham striker Jermain Defoe has said that the club should do everything that they can in order to keep winger Gareth Bale at the club. The 23-year-old Welshman has been linked with some of the biggest clubs in the world like Real Madrid, who are prepared to pay in excess of £ 50 million for the player.

Bale managed to win both PFA awards on offer last season, thus becoming the first player since Cristiano Ronaldo to do so. He is also amongst the elite players to have achieved this feat in the same season. Thierry Henry and Cristiano Ronaldo are the other players.

Bale has reiterated his desire to play in the Champions League, but there are huge fears that he may be prepared to look elsewhere after Tottenham yet again failed to qualify for this competition. However, they came extremely close only because of the brilliance of Bale.
